ACH - Air Changes per Hour

By , About.com Guide

Definition:
ACH is an acronym for Air Changes per Hour and is a measurement of air infiltration. It is the total volume of air in a home that is turned over in one hour. Tightly constructed homes may have an ACH of 0.25 to 0.35 ACH.

A typically built new home may have an ACH of around 1.75 ACH. Older poorly weatherstripped and sealed homes may have higher than 2.5 ACH.
